Description

Advanced well concepts including horizontal and multilateral wells have become a dominant feature of new field development and redevelopment opportunities. They can, when used appropriately, dramatically improve the economic profitability of field development operations. However, the success of deployment largely depends on the effectiveness of assessment of the longer term production dynamics essential to ensuring “life of well” design criteria and effective reservoir management.

The course will discuss the subjects of multilateral well applications, pros and cons, the classification of junction and completion, well performance, and problem diagnosis. The application and benefits of horizontal and multilateral wells are analyzed. Methods to predict well performance and recovery from horizontal and multilateral wells are presented. The integration of inflow and wellbore flow performance for individual horizontal and multilateral wells is discussed. Well completion options for horizontal and multilateral wells are summarized. The objective is to be able to identify the candidates for the technology, and to be able to design a well that will optimize production.

Professor of Petroleum Engineering
Texas A&M University
Dr. Ding Zhu is an Assistant Professor at Petroleum Engineering Department at Texas A&M University. Before joining Texas A&M, she was a Research Scientist at The University of Texas at Austin. Since 1992, Dr. Ding Zhu has conducted and supervised research projects in production engineering, well stimulation, and complex well-performance. Dr. Zhu is a member of Society of Petroleum Engineers (SPE), and author of more than sixty technical papers. She has been a committee member for many SPE conferences and events, and a technical editor for SPE Production and Facilities Journal.

 Dr. Zhu has developed several comprehensive computer software applications for production engineering, many of which have been adopted by industry sponsors. She developed the production engineering software package, PPS, which has been widely used in teaching and in the field worldwide. She has also taught numerous industry short courses on well stimulation, well performance improvement, and horizontal/multilateral wells.
